1
0
mirror of https://github.com/lensapp/lens.git synced 2025-05-20 05:10:56 +00:00

Linter fixes

Signed-off-by: Alex Andreev <alex.andreev.email@gmail.com>
This commit is contained in:
Alex Andreev 2023-06-01 14:09:38 +03:00
parent 41732254f1
commit 0f4155672c
4 changed files with 15 additions and 7 deletions

View File

@ -33,8 +33,8 @@ import type { ToggleTableColumnVisibility } from "../../../features/user-prefere
import toggleTableColumnVisibilityInjectable from "../../../features/user-preferences/common/toggle-table-column-visibility.injectable"; import toggleTableColumnVisibilityInjectable from "../../../features/user-preferences/common/toggle-table-column-visibility.injectable";
import type { IsTableColumnHidden } from "../../../features/user-preferences/common/is-table-column-hidden.injectable"; import type { IsTableColumnHidden } from "../../../features/user-preferences/common/is-table-column-hidden.injectable";
import isTableColumnHiddenInjectable from "../../../features/user-preferences/common/is-table-column-hidden.injectable"; import isTableColumnHiddenInjectable from "../../../features/user-preferences/common/is-table-column-hidden.injectable";
import { AddOrRemoveButtons, AddRemoveButtonsProps, TableComponent, addOrRemoveButtonsInjectionToken } from "@k8slens/table"; import type { AddOrRemoveButtons, AddRemoveButtonsProps, TableComponent } from "@k8slens/table";
import { tableComponentInjectionToken } from "@k8slens/table"; import { addOrRemoveButtonsInjectionToken, tableComponentInjectionToken } from "@k8slens/table";
export interface ItemListLayoutContentProps<Item extends ItemObject, PreLoadStores extends boolean> { export interface ItemListLayoutContentProps<Item extends ItemObject, PreLoadStores extends boolean> {
getFilters: () => Filter[]; getFilters: () => Filter[];
@ -302,7 +302,7 @@ class NonInjectedItemListLayoutContent<
const { const {
store, hasDetailsView, addRemoveButtons = {}, virtual, sortingCallbacks, store, hasDetailsView, addRemoveButtons = {}, virtual, sortingCallbacks,
detailsItem, className, tableProps = {}, tableId, getItems, activeTheme, detailsItem, className, tableProps = {}, tableId, getItems, activeTheme,
table, addOrRemoveButtons table, addOrRemoveButtons,
} = this.props; } = this.props;
const selectedItemId = detailsItem && detailsItem.getId(); const selectedItemId = detailsItem && detailsItem.getId();
const classNames = cssNames(className, "box", "grow", activeTheme.get().type); const classNames = cssNames(className, "box", "grow", activeTheme.get().type);

View File

@ -1,3 +1,7 @@
/**
* Copyright (c) OpenLens Authors. All rights reserved.
* Licensed under MIT License. See LICENSE in root directory for more information.
*/
import { getInjectable } from "@ogre-tools/injectable"; import { getInjectable } from "@ogre-tools/injectable";
import { AddRemoveButtons } from "@k8slens/core/renderer"; import { AddRemoveButtons } from "@k8slens/core/renderer";
import { addOrRemoveButtonsInjectionToken } from "@k8slens/table"; import { addOrRemoveButtonsInjectionToken } from "@k8slens/table";
@ -8,4 +12,4 @@ const addRemoveButtonsInjectable = getInjectable({
injectionToken: addOrRemoveButtonsInjectionToken, injectionToken: addOrRemoveButtonsInjectionToken,
}); });
export default addRemoveButtonsInjectable export default addRemoveButtonsInjectable;

View File

@ -1,3 +1,7 @@
/**
* Copyright (c) OpenLens Authors. All rights reserved.
* Licensed under MIT License. See LICENSE in root directory for more information.
*/
import { tableComponentInjectionToken } from "@k8slens/table"; import { tableComponentInjectionToken } from "@k8slens/table";
import { getInjectable } from "@ogre-tools/injectable"; import { getInjectable } from "@ogre-tools/injectable";
import { Table } from "@k8slens/core/renderer"; import { Table } from "@k8slens/core/renderer";
@ -8,4 +12,4 @@ const tableComponentInjectable = getInjectable({
injectionToken: tableComponentInjectionToken, injectionToken: tableComponentInjectionToken,
}); });
export default tableComponentInjectable export default tableComponentInjectable;